1. Pencil2D
Pencil2D is a free and open-source animation software that is perfect for beginners who are just starting out in the world of animation. This program is easy to use and offers a straightforward interface that allows users to create hand-drawn animations with ease. Pencil2D’s simple tools and features make it a great option for those who are new to animation and want to experiment with different styles and techniques.
2. Synfig Studio
Synfig Studio is another free and open-source animation program that is ideal for beginners. This software offers a wide range of tools and features that allow users to create professional-looking animations without the hefty price tag. With Synfig Studio, beginners can work with vector graphics and create captivating animations that rival those made by seasoned professionals. The program also has a helpful community of users who can provide support and guidance as you navigate through the world of animation.
3. Adobe Animate
Adobe Animate is a popular animation program that is widely used in the industry. While Adobe Animate does come with a subscription fee, it is well worth the investment for beginners who are serious about honing their animation skills. This program offers a comprehensive suite of tools and features that allow users to create a wide range of animations, from 2D cartoons to interactive web animations. Adobe Animate also integrates seamlessly with other Adobe Creative Cloud programs, making it easy to incorporate your animations into other creative projects.
4. Toon Boom Harmony
Toon Boom Harmony is a professional-grade animation program that is perfect for beginners who are looking to take their skills to the next level. While Toon Boom Harmony does come with a price tag, it offers an extensive set of tools and features that allow users to create high-quality animations with ease. This program is used by professional animators in the industry and is known for its versatility and power. With Toon Boom Harmony, beginners can create stunning animations that rival those seen in movies and television shows.
5. Stop Motion Studio
Stop Motion Studio is a fun and user-friendly animation program that is perfect for beginners who are interested in creating stop-motion animations. This program allows users to capture images with their camera and string them together to create seamless animations. Stop Motion Studio offers a variety of tools and features, such as onion skinning and time-lapse recording, that make it easy for beginners to create captivating stop-motion animations. Whether you are interested in creating claymation shorts or puppet animations, Stop Motion Studio is a great option for beginners looking to explore the world of stop-motion animation.
